Contouring and Highlighting with Black Opal

Awhile back Black Opal sent me some great foundations to try out and I love them! I have been using there products for years! I love that they cater to women of color and it's so affordable. They are available online and at CVS, Rite Aid and Duane Reade just to name a few. Here is what I used:

Face: MAC Strobe Cream, Primer, Black Opal Suede Mocha for contour, Nutmeg for the face and Heavenly Honey for highlighting. I set my faced with Black Opal translucent pressed powder and Ben Nye banana powder

Cheek: MAC Blunt powder blush for contouring, MAC Give Me Sun Mineralized Skinfinish, and Milani Dolce Vita baked blush 

Eyes: Milani eyeshadow primer, MAC Hepcat eyeshadow on lid, Brownscript in cease, and Brûlée on brow bone, Carbon eyeshadow smudged on lash line, Ardell 120 Demi lashes and Rimmel Scandal eyes pencil in black on waterline

Lips: EOS lip balm, MAC Faux lipstick and Oyster Girl in center of lips.

This technique of contouring and highlighting I prefer for blogging and going out. I know a lot of people due it everyday but it's time consuming and you really have to blend. Hope this was helpful.
